How do you copy all the odd rows in Excel?

In an adjacent column, use the =ISEVEN() or =ISODD() function, combined with a ROW() function that references any cell in that row. Double-click the cell’s fill handle to copy the formula to the remaining range.

How do you select odd numbers in Excel?

You can also apply the formula of =ISODD(A1) to identify the number in Column A are odd or not, and then filter them. The formula of =MOD(A1,2) is also available to determine the number in Cell A1 is even or not. If the number in Cell A1 is even, it returns 0, otherwise 1 for odd numbers.

How do you highlight odd rows?

Apply color to alternate rows or columns

  1. Select the range of cells that you want to format.
  2. Click Home > Format as Table.
  3. Pick a table style that has alternate row shading.
  4. To change the shading from rows to columns, select the table, click Design, and then uncheck the Banded Rows box and check the Banded Columns box.

How do you even out rows in Excel?

How to Space Equally in Excel

  1. Click the row number of the array’s top row.
  2. Drag your cursor to select every row in the array.
  3. Right-click the selected cells to open a context menu.
  4. Click “Row height” to open the Row Height dialog box.
  5. Type a height into the box.
  6. Press “Enter” to assign the height to the selected rows.
